Output e4a2d6dfe638fc6dd9e69cf489cc1aca2ab9c9632e67080aa7c3e9057c1d2691:1

value
2862605
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6cfafc94578edc5d79bdf41aff7b5ad172789e0a OP_EQUAL
address
3BdFa7qvN63VaHbk1Ka2zBsyZS6scdDgKH
transaction
e4a2d6dfe638fc6dd9e69cf489cc1aca2ab9c9632e67080aa7c3e9057c1d2691
spent
true